Yammer’s a popular enterprise social networking tool that is very much like a private Facebook for the enterprise. IBM Lotus Connections. IBM’s social suite is supported on a range of mobile platforms , including Android, iPad, iPhone, BlackBerry and Nokia and iPhone. Yammer. Touchdown. Soonr. MORE >> -
